Learn R Programming

RPPASPACE (version 1.0.10)

LogisticFitClass-class: Class “LogisticFitClass”

Description

The LogisticFitClass class represents models that were fit with the logistic model.

Usage

# S4 method for LogisticFitClass
coef(object, ...)
# S4 method for LogisticFitClass
coefficients(object, ...)
# S4 method for LogisticFitClass
fitSeries(object,
          diln,
          intensity,
          est.conc,
          method="nls",
          silent=TRUE,
          trace=FALSE,
          ...)
# S4 method for LogisticFitClass
fitSlide(object,
         conc,
         intensity,
         ...)
# S4 method for LogisticFitClass
fitted(object,
       conc,
       ...)
# S4 method for LogisticFitClass
trimConc(object,
         conc,
         intensity,
         design,
         trimLevel,
         ...)

Value

The coef and coefficients methods return a named vector of length three with logistic curve coefficients.

The fitted method returns a numeric vector.

Arguments

object

object of class LogisticFitClass

diln

numeric vector of dilutions for series to be fit

intensity

numeric vector of observed intensities for series to be fit

est.conc

numeric estimated concentration for EC50 dilution

method

character string specifying regression method to use to fit the series

silent

logical scalar. If TRUE, report of error messages will be suppressed in try(nlsmeth(...))

trace

logical scalar. Used in nls method.

conc

numeric vector containing estimates of the log concentration for each dilution series

design

object of class RPPADesignParams describing options for processing the array

trimLevel

numeric scalar multiplied to Median Absolute Deviation MAD

...

extra arguments for generic routines

Objects from the Class

Objects are created internally by calls to the methods fitSlide or RPPAFit.

Slots

coefficients:

numeric vector of length 3, representing alpha, beta, and gamma respectively.

Extends

Class FitClass, directly.

Methods

coef

signature(object = "LogisticFitClass"):
Extracts model coefficients from objects returned by modeling functions.

coefficients

signature(object = "LogisticFitClass"):
An alias for coef

fitSeries

signature(object = "LogisticFitClass"):
Finds the concentration for an individual dilution series given the curve fit for the slide.

fitSlide

signature(object = "LogisticFitClass"):
Uses the concentration and intensity series for an entire slide to fit a curve for the slide of intensity = f(conc).

fitted

signature(object = "LogisticFitClass"):
Extracts fitted values of the model.

trimConc

signature(object = "LogisticFitClass"):
Returns concentration and intensity cutoffs for the model.

Author

P. Roebuck paul_roebuck@comcast.net, James M. Melott jmmelott@mdanderson.org

See Also

FitClass